    Associate Director - Project Management - Local Government

    Safety first - Going home safe and well: 

    • You will be a leading advocate of Mace's value of Safety First, and be accountable for leading and maintaining exceptional safety, quality, cost, programme, sustainability and project compliance standards. 
    • You will possess advanced technical expertise in local Health and Safety rules and regulations relevant to project portfolio. 
    • You will champion a diverse and inclusive working environment, and understand the importance of the wellbeing of the people you manage.  

    Client focus – Deliver on our promise: 

    • You will ensure the successful delivery of key assignments and defined business areas, providing strategic direction and monitoring delivery aligned with overall vision and objectives. 
    • You will be responsible for implementing appropriate programme delivery environments, including People, Organisation, Process, Information and Technology 
    • You will promote and influence quality and Service Excellence in all conversations and programme interactions. 

    Integrity – Always do the right thing: 

    • You will be responsible for project budgets and ensure operations are fiscally and ethically viable, and meet organisational and legislative compliance obligations. 
    • You will support the Operations Director and other senior stakeholders to directly influence long term development of strategy for a function or Business Unit (BU), creating a sustainable business future. 
    • You will commit to making a positive impact for our people, our clients, and our planet, and take ownership for holding others to account who do not uphold the Mace values.  

    Create opportunity for our people to excel: 

    • You will lead your team effectively and develop others to reach their full potential.  
    • You will actively network, innovate, and seek understanding of best practice, utilising the full depth of knowledge of Mace Group, the Centres of Excellence, Mace Way Control Centre and Knowledge Hub. 
    • You will collaborate with multiple internal and external stakeholders, up to C-Suite, to implement and manage our programmes. 

    You’ll need to have: 

    • Tertiary qualifications in project management and / or construction related discipline or equivalent professional experience / apprenticeship.
    • Demonstrable level of knowledge

    You’ll also have 

    • Membership of RICS, CIOB, APM, ICE or equivalent demonstrable professional or personal development.  
    • Extensive experience in the successful delivery phase of projects and programmes in the construction sector. 
    • Deep property or infrastructure project management expertise.  
    • Strong commercial and financial acumen.  
    • Leadership and management experience of large, diverse teams.  
    • Experience of managing relationships with key senior stakeholders.  
    • Knowledge of how carbon and sustainability considerations will shape the outlook of the projects you are working on
